Web1 Kurt Vonnegut’s Slaughterhouse-Five, or the Children’s Crusade: A Duty-Dance With Death (commonly referred to as Slaughterhouse-Five), published in 1969, tells the story of Billy Pilgrim and his experiences before, during and after World War II. It is, in many regards, a highly unconventional novel. WebBilly Pilgrim does not have to have PTSD for Slaughterhouse Five to be an allegory for PTSD. Billy Pilgrim could just be a regular guy abducted by toilet plunger shaped aliens and it still works as commentary on the atrocities of war leaving people with trauma. 29 Late-Project-1441 • 21 days ago
